Madison, AL – Major Crash Causes Delays on I-565 East at Glenn Hearn Blvd

February 13, 2025
Spread the love

Madison, AL (February 13, 2025) – A major crash on eastbound Interstate 565 near mile marker 7.78 at Glenn Hearn Boulevard caused significant delays Thursday afternoon, according to local traffic reports.

The crash was reported around 3:53 p.m., prompting emergency responders to the scene. Authorities have not yet confirmed the number of vehicles involved or the extent of injuries, but the incident caused major traffic congestion in the area.

Drivers were urged to seek alternate routes while officials worked to clear the roadway and investigate the cause of the crash.
